用Python画网络拓扑图,具体怎么操作?需要哪些库和步骤?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python-scikittdaPython拓扑数据分析包
1. **导入库**: 首先,你需要导入必要的模块,如 `sktda` 和其他数据处理库,如 `numpy` 和 `matplotlib`。 2. **预处理数据**: 对原始数据进行清洗和转换,使其适合进行拓扑分析。 3. **构建过滤器**: 根据数据的...
python networkx
NetworkX是一个Python的开源库,用于创建、操作复杂网络结构和进行网络分析,它提供了一系列的算法和数据结构来表示、操作和研究结构。networkx包是数据科学领域中处理网络数据的重要工具之一,尤其在社会网络分析、...
Python自动化网络运维[可运行源码]
首先,通过介绍Python中广泛使用的graphviz库,读者将了解到如何使用这个库来生成清晰的网络拓扑图。graphviz库能够将图形化的网络结构以代码的形式呈现,并通过Python的图形化处理能力,将这些代码转化为直观的图形...
五种网络拓扑结构的生成(MATLAB+Python) 五种网络拓扑结构的生成:总线型,星型,网状,树型,环型.zip
Python中,可以使用`networkx`库创建和操作网络拓扑,配合`matplotlib`库进行图形显示。具体实现步骤可能包括创建节点、定义连接关系、绘制网络图以及模拟数据传输等。 在`a.txt`和`all`这两个文件中,很可能是详细...
Python-diagram使用UTF8字符和花哨的颜色基于Python的文本模式图
"Python-diagram"库基于Python,它通过简单的API设计,让开发者能够轻松创建各种图表,如流程图、树状图和网络拓扑图等。在命令行界面中,它通过巧妙地使用不同UTF-8字符来构建图形结构,并结合色彩,使得这些文本图...
教主Kali与Python黑客 目录与拓扑
拓扑结构是指网络拓扑结构,Kali Linux提供了多种拓扑结构工具,如Nmap、Nessus等,可以用来扫描目标网络,生成拓扑结构图。 Metasploit框架 Metasploit是一个流行的漏洞攻击框架,提供了大量的漏洞攻击模块,可以...
python实现人物关系网.rar
4. **图论**:使用`networkx`库创建和操作有向图。在人物关系网中,每个节点表示一个人物,每条边表示从一个角色到另一个角色的关系。`networkx`提供了丰富的功能,如添加节点、添加边、计算路径、社区检测等。 5. ...
Python电力系统潮流计算
3. **构建方程**:潮流计算基于KCL(基尔霍夫电流定律)和KVL(基尔霍夫电压定律),我们需要根据网络拓扑构造相应的非线性方程组。 4. **求解方程**:使用选定的求解器,解决这些非线性方程,得到各节点电压和支路...
Kernighan-Lin图分割算法在Python中的实现_python_代码_下载
Kernighan-Lin图分割算法是一种经典的图划分方法,主要应用于解决图的最小割问题,比如在...在实际开发中,这种算法可以被用来优化分布式系统中的资源分配、改善网络拓扑结构,或者帮助解决其他需要分割数据集的问题。
复杂网络分析相关节点指标,复杂网络关键节点识别,Python
NetworkX是一个强大的开源库,提供了创建、操作和研究复杂网络结构、算法和特性的功能。以下是一般步骤: 1. **导入库**:首先,我们需要导入NetworkX库和其他必要的库,如NumPy和Matplotlib。 ```python import ...
Python库 | sgdotlite-1.0.13.tar.gz
为了充分利用这个库,开发者需要查看其官方文档或README文件,了解新版本的具体变更和使用方法。 Python库的使用通常涉及以下步骤: 1. 安装:可以通过pip(Python的包管理器)进行安装,命令可能是`pip install ...
链路预测 python
在Python中,可以使用如NetworkX、igraph、Graph-tool等库来构建和操作图结构。这些库允许我们创建节点和边,进行各种图的分析,如度分布、聚类系数、最短路径等,这些都是链路预测的重要指标。 对于链路预测算法,...
基于python实现 C_S 以及 P2P 文件传输.zip
P2P文件传输的另一个重点是网络拓扑管理和文件定位,这通常涉及到DHT(分布式哈希表)技术,如Kademlia算法,Python中也有现成的库如libtorrent可以用来实现DHT网络。 除了上述技术细节,本项目还需考虑文件传输的...
python实现了图卷积神经网络的功能
在实践中,GCN模型的构建通常包括图的邻接矩阵和特征矩阵的初始化,接着是多层图卷积操作的堆叠,每层操作都包括特征转换和邻居聚合两个步骤。特征转换是通过可学习的参数矩阵对当前层节点的特征进行线性变换,而...
卷积网络单幅图像去雨,图网络和图卷积网络,Python源码.zip
具体到这个压缩包,可能包含了使用Python实现的CNN和GCN图像去雨模型的源代码。开发者可能已经预处理了雨天图像数据集,并定义了相应的训练和测试流程。源码中可能会有详细的注释,解释每个部分的功能和实现细节。...
Python3+MATLAB无线传感器网络相关仿真 基于RSSI测距的多边定位法仿真 生成五种网络拓扑结构源码.zip
在这个项目中,学生不仅需要掌握无线传感器网络的基本概念,还需要熟悉Python和MATLAB编程,了解RSSI测距原理,理解不同网络拓扑对定位性能的影响,以及如何通过编程实现和评估定位算法。这样的项目能够提供实践经验...
Packt.Mastering.Python.Networking.2017
这部分将介绍如何使用Python结合Graphviz来生成网络拓扑图。 - **基于流的监控**:基于流的监控技术(如NetFlow、IPFIX等)可以提供更细粒度的流量分析。这部分将介绍这些技术,并演示如何使用Python进行数据分析。...
Python库 | osm2gmns-0.6.2-py3-none-any.whl
**Python库osm2gmns 0.6.2版本详解** `osm2gmns` 是一个Python库,主要用于将OpenStreetMap (OSM) 数据转换为GMNS(Global Model for ...对于需要进行交通网络分析的用户,掌握这个库的使用方法和原理是非常有价值的。
Python库 | autonetkit-0.2.29.tar.gz
Autonetkit是一个基于Python的开源网络自动化工具,主要设计用于快速构建和测试网络拓扑。它提供了一种简洁的API,允许开发者用Python代码定义网络结构,然后自动配置虚拟设备,如路由器、交换机等,并进行网络模拟...
python画图程序.zip
更进一步,如果是一个特定领域的画图程序,比如用于绘制网络拓扑图的,那么它可能会包含用于构建特定图模型和节点关系的代码。如果是用于生物信息学的数据可视化,那么可能包含了用于展示基因序列、蛋白质结构等复杂...
最新推荐


![Python自动化网络运维[可运行源码]](https://img-home.csdnimg.cn/images/20210720083736.png)

